Which scriptures stress hope in God?
What other scriptures emphasize hope and security in God?

Setting the Anchor: Job 11:18

Job 11:18: “You will be secure, because there is hope; you will look about you and lie down in safety.”

Security and hope travel together. When God is the object of hope, rest naturally follows.


Hope Echoed in the Psalms

Psalm 16:8-9 – “I have set the LORD always before me. Because He is at my right hand, I will not be shaken. Therefore my heart is glad and my tongue rejoices; my body also will dwell in safety.”

Psalm 18:2 – “The LORD is my rock, my fortress, and my deliverer, my God is my rock in whom I take refuge.”

Psalm 27:1 – “The LORD is my light and my salvation—whom shall I fear? The LORD is the stronghold of my life—whom shall I dread?”

Psalm 62:5-6 – “Rest in God alone, O my soul, for my hope comes from Him. He alone is my rock and my salvation.”

Psalm 91:1-2 – “He who dwells in the shelter of the Most High will abide in the shadow of the Almighty. I will say to the LORD, ‘You are my refuge and my fortress.’”


Assurance through the Prophets

Isaiah 26:3-4 – “You will keep in perfect peace the steadfast of mind, because he trusts in You. Trust in the LORD forever, for the LORD GOD is an everlasting rock.”

Isaiah 40:31 – “But those who hope in the LORD will renew their strength; they will soar on wings like eagles.”

Jeremiah 17:7-8 – “Blessed is the man who trusts in the LORD, whose confidence is in Him. He will be like a tree planted by the waters… its leaves are always green.”

Zephaniah 3:17 – “The LORD your God is in your midst, a mighty Savior. He will rejoice over you with gladness; He will quiet you with His love.”


Jesus: Hope Made Flesh

John 10:28-29 – “I give them eternal life, and they will never perish. No one can snatch them out of My hand.”

John 14:27 – “Peace I leave with you; My peace I give you… Do not let your hearts be troubled and do not be afraid.”

Matthew 11:28-29 – “Come to Me, all you who are weary and burdened, and I will give you rest.”


Apostolic Confidence

Romans 8:38-39 – “For I am convinced that neither death nor life… nor anything else in all creation, will be able to separate us from the love of God in Christ Jesus our Lord.”

Romans 15:13 – “May the God of hope fill you with all joy and peace as you believe, so that you may overflow with hope by the power of the Holy Spirit.”

2 Thessalonians 3:3 – “But the Lord is faithful, and He will strengthen you and guard you from the evil one.”

Hebrews 6:19 – “We have this hope as an anchor for the soul, firm and secure.”

1 Peter 1:3-5 – God “has given us new birth into a living hope… kept in heaven for you, who through faith are shielded by God’s power.”


Practical Takeaways

• Scripture consistently pairs hope with safety, assurance, and rest.

• Whether voiced by Job’s friend, sung by David, preached by prophets, or fulfilled in Christ, the promise remains: trusting God plants us in unshakeable security.
